Redmayne gushes over 'extraordinary' role as father


Rio de Janeiro, Aug 9 (IANS): Academy Award-winning actor Eddie Redmayne says he is loving his "extraordinary" role as father to his seven-week-old daughter Iris.

Redmayne spoke about parenthood for the first time about becoming a father.

The Oscar-winner and his wife Hannah are currently in Rio with their daughter to watch the Olympic Games. He was asked about life with his daughter as he attended the Omega House opening night party on Saturday, reports hellomagazine.com.

“Well, it's only seven weeks in, but it's amazing. It's wonderful. All of the stuff you've heard for years, it's all true but utterly extraordinary,” Redmayne said.

He added: “We were given the opportunity of coming to Rio; I've never been to South America. The notion of coming to Brazil and Rio was extraordinary. And the idea of bringing Iris on her first trip abroad to the Olympics in Brazil was too much of an extraordinary opportunity to turn down."
